The Digital Hermeneutic: How NLP Unlocks Cross-Tradition Theological Research
Introduction
For centuries, the study of theology was bound by the physical constraints of the library. Scholars spent lifetimes mastering individual traditions, often leaving the vast connections between disparate religious texts—such as the thematic resonances between Buddhist sutras and Christian mysticism—to the realm of intuitive insight rather than systematic proof. Today, Natural Language Processing (NLP) is dismantling these barriers.
By transforming ancient, sacred, and philosophical texts into structured data, NLP allows researchers to perform “distant reading.” This computational approach does not replace the close, meditative reading of primary sources; rather, it empowers scholars to surface hidden patterns, trace the evolution of concepts across linguistic divides, and build a cohesive map of human belief systems. This article explores how you can leverage these tools to conduct sophisticated comparative theology.
Key Concepts
To use NLP effectively, one must understand how computers “read” theology. At its core, NLP relies on several foundational technologies:
- Word Embeddings (Vector Space Modeling): Algorithms like Word2Vec or BERT translate words into numerical vectors. If two concepts—for example, “grace” in Christianity and “karuna” (compassion) in Mahayana Buddhism—appear in similar grammatical contexts across a corpus, the model places them near each other in a multi-dimensional space. This allows you to quantify thematic proximity.
- Topic Modeling (LDA/BERTopic): Latent Dirichlet Allocation (LDA) automatically identifies clusters of words that frequently appear together, labeling them as distinct “topics.” This helps researchers categorize thousands of pages of text without manual tagging.
- Semantic Similarity Search: Unlike keyword searches, which only find exact matches, semantic search understands intent. A query for “the nature of the soul” will return results containing “atman,” “psyche,” and “nefesh,” even if the specific query word is absent.
Step-by-Step Guide
If you are a scholar or researcher looking to bridge traditions, follow this systematic workflow to ensure your computational results are academically rigorous.
- Data Curation and Standardization: Before processing, you must clean your corpus. Ensure that multi-lingual texts have been normalized—either through high-quality translations or, ideally, by using cross-lingual embeddings that align different languages into a shared vector space.
- Preprocessing: Use lemmatization to reduce words to their root forms (e.g., “praying,” “prayed,” and “prayers” all become “pray”). This ensures the model treats these variations as a single theological concept.
- Vectorization: Convert your cleaned text into vectors using pre-trained transformer models (like RoBERTa or multilingual BERT). These models have already been trained on massive datasets, including theological literature, allowing them to capture nuanced syntactic structures.
- Thematic Clustering: Run a clustering algorithm (like K-Means or HDBSCAN) on your vectors. This will group segments of text by thematic affinity. Look for clusters that span multiple traditions; these are your primary “cross-reference” points.
- Validation via “Close Reading”: Computational results are merely hypotheses. Once the NLP identifies a correlation, return to the primary texts to verify the context. Computational theology serves as an index for human insight, not a replacement for hermeneutics.
Examples and Case Studies
The practical application of these tools is already changing the field. Consider the following use cases:
The study of “asceticism” across traditions often relies on anecdotal evidence. By using NLP to map the linguistic landscape of “renunciation” in Desert Father writings versus the monastic codes of the Vinaya Pitaka, researchers have identified shared patterns in vocabulary related to food, silence, and social detachment, suggesting a cross-cultural “theology of the body” that transcended geographic proximity.
Another compelling application involves the study of “negative theology” (apophaticism). By using sentiment analysis and negation detection in NLP, researchers have mapped the linguistic “voids”—the specific grammatical structures used to describe the Ineffable—across the works of Pseudo-Dionysius and the Tao Te Ching. The software reveals that both traditions utilize a shared syntactic “bracketing” technique, providing objective evidence for a structural similarity in how humans grapple with the Divine.
Common Mistakes
Even seasoned researchers fall into traps when applying data science to theological texts. Avoid these pitfalls to maintain the integrity of your research:
- Ignoring Historical Context (Anachronism): A model might link two concepts simply because they use similar vocabulary. However, a word like “Spirit” in a 2nd-century Gnostic text carries a vastly different semantic weight than in a 20th-century Protestant tract. Always filter your data by historical period before running models.
- Over-reliance on Translation Bias: If you use machine translations, you are analyzing the translator’s theology, not the original author’s. Whenever possible, use parallel corpora where the original text is linked to a rigorously checked scholarly translation.
- Confirmation Bias: It is easy to “force” a model to find what you expect to see. Use unsupervised learning (where the machine discovers clusters on its own) rather than purely supervised classification to avoid circular reasoning.
Advanced Tips
To move beyond basic cross-referencing, incorporate these advanced methodologies:
Diachronic Modeling: Instead of looking at a static snapshot, use diachronic NLP to track how the semantic meaning of a theological term (e.g., “logos”) shifted over centuries. This allows you to visualize the evolution of a concept as it traveled from Greek philosophy into early Christian theology.
Graph-Based Network Analysis: Once your NLP identifies thematic connections, export the data into network analysis software (like Gephi). Create nodes for themes and edges for relationships. This creates a visual “map of ideas” that shows not just what themes are related, but how they cluster into central doctrines versus peripheral concepts.
Named Entity Recognition (NER) for Personas: Customize your NER models to recognize specific theological personas (e.g., “the prophet,” “the mystic,” “the lawgiver”). You can then compare how different traditions describe the *function* of these personas, even when the titles differ entirely.
Conclusion
The integration of NLP into theological scholarship is not about reducing sacred wisdom to mere code. It is about expanding our capacity to listen to the “great conversation” of human history. By utilizing computational tools to cross-reference themes, scholars can move past the limitations of siloed research and uncover the profound, often unexpected, symmetries between the world’s great traditions.
As you begin your own digital research, remember that technology provides the map, but you remain the guide. Use these tools to identify the connections that matter, apply your hermeneutical expertise to interpret them, and contribute to a more interconnected understanding of human spirituality.





Leave a Reply